The TRI AVATAR is a next-generation chorus pedal with a total of four signal paths: three chorus sounds (three phases) and a dry signal. When used in stereo, the first phase is on the left channel, the second phase is on the left and right channels, and the third phase is on the right.
The chorus sound is assigned to the right (R) side in the second phase. When used in mono, all three phases are mixed. By mixing and outputting three individual chorus sounds, it creates a chorus sound with a breadth and depth that surpasses that of typical stereo choruses. Furthermore, conventional choruses had several problems, such as pitch deviations, blurred sound images in the low frequencies, and noise generation at the timing of the modulation. Free The Tone has combined analog and digital technologies and solved these problems with its unique know-how, resulting in a completely new chorus pedal.

While the previous TA-1H had four presets for saving settings, the new TA-2H significantly increases that number to 128. It also features the same AD/DA converter used in FLIGHT TIME (digital delay), allowing you to enjoy a warmer mid-low frequency sound.
